Car bomb kills 11 in Iraqi city

0 Comments | AFP, April, 2008

BAQUBA, Iraq (AFP) — At least 11 people were killed and 40 wounded when a car bomb ripped through a crowd outside a courthouse in the Iraqi city of Baquba on Tuesday, Iraqi officials said.

"At least 11 people were killed and 40 wounded, among them women and children, when a car bomb exploded outside the main courthouse in Baquba at around 11:30 am (0830 GMT)," said a police official who would not be named.

Dr Ahmed Fuad at the local hospital in Baquba, 60 kilometres (35 miles) north of Baghdad, said 11 bodies had already been brought to the hospital.

"We have at least 40 wounded people, among them women and children," he told AFP.
